NetScaler is an advanced application delivery controller providing load balancing, SSL offloading, and enhanced network performance. Users benefit from its robust security features, seamless Citrix integrations, and cost-effective infrastructure.
Designed to optimize and secure application delivery, NetScaler offers high availability and supports data centers with its load balancing and reverse proxy capabilities. It ensures effective traffic management and provides valuable insights into network health while integrating easily with Citrix products. Users appreciate its centralized management via ADM and flexible deployment options tailored to their infrastructure needs. However, there is room for improvement in its management tools, interface, and documentation, alongside a need for security enhancements and better licensing flexibility.
